Priyanka Chopra Jonas offers insights into her life and work while filming S. S. Rajamouli's Varanasi in Hyderabad, sharing a candid photo compilation.

Priyanka Chopra Jonas recently shared a collection of personal photographs, providing her followers with a look into both her professional and private life. The actress is currently in Hyderabad filming for S. S. Rajamouli’s upcoming film, Varanasi, which also stars Mahesh Babu and Prithviraj Sukumaran.

In a post on Instagram, Chopra shared several candid images that captured various snippets from her life. Among the pictures were moments showcasing her in a scuba diving suit, notes of her feature in a magazine, and references to films she enjoys, including classic Indian movies such as Hum Aapke Hain Koun...? and Hum Dil De Chuke Sanam. The photos also included a nostalgic clip of the late actress Sridevi dancing to "Kaate Nahi Kat Te Ye Din" from the iconic film Mr. India.

Chopra’s post aimed to provide a slice of her everyday experiences, with one image taken at a Gurudwara, reflecting a blend of work and personal time. Her caption, “Some here… some there…” summed up the diverse moments she chose to share with her audience.

The film Varanasi presents the adventures of Rudhra, set against the backdrop of the ancient Indian city of Varanasi, which faces a threat from an incoming asteroid. The storyline spans multiple timelines and continents, making it an ambitious project. Rajamouli, known for his grand cinematic scale, has reportedly conceived Varanasi as a global adventure rooted in Indian culture, with influences drawn from classic adventure films.

Filming locations for Varanasi extend beyond Hyderabad, with scenes also shot in Odisha and Kenya. With an estimated budget between Rs. 1,000 and 1,300 crore, Varanasi is poised to become one of the most expensive films produced in India. The film is slated for theatrical release on April 7, 2027.

In addition to Varanasi, Priyanka Chopra is set to return to the Krrish franchise for Krrish 4, marking Hrithik Roshan’s debut as a director. Chopra began her acting career in 2002 with the Tamil film Thamizhan, followed by her Bollywood debut in The Hero: Love Story of a Spy in 2003. She has since starred in numerous successful films, with her standout role in the romantic thriller Aitraaz cementing her status as a leading actress in Indian cinema.
